Joose isn’t for kids anymore
So, I went to the local Shop Rite supermarket on Saturday and wanted to get myself some chilled alcoholic beverages for personal consumption, and I came across this:

This energy drink looks like any typical drink you can buy at your local gas station, but upon closer inspection this one contains ALCOHOL! 9.0% alcohol to be precise. You really have to examine the can to find that out, but it’s on there.
The problem with designs like this can is that anyone could mistaken it for a typical energy drink. If an adult had a teenager with them and the kid thought it was a regular drink the parent could have bought it without realizing. The only good thing (about Shop Rite) is that the liquor department is a completely different section of the store and this was located there and nowhere else.
The cost of this 23.5oz can was $2.99 (less than a regular energy drink of that size). I purchased it curious to see what it tastes like, since I am a fan of the energy drink phenom. I was hoping that it would have some alcohol taste to it to discourage kids from drinking it. Fortunately, I was correct on that. This drink tasted like Peach Schnapps. It was very strong! I have had Schnapps before and have enjoyed it, but this drink was horrible. I was cringing everytime that I took a sip of it. It did hit me hard, don’t get me wrong on that, but I will never buy it again.
